What is CVE-2026-20245?
A zero-day vulnerability (CVE-2026-20245) in Cisco Catalyst SD-WAN Manager was exploited in early 2026 to target a service provider's SD-WAN infrastructure. The flaw allowed a threat actor to gain initial access to the system. Immediate application of Cisco's security update and review of network activity are recommended.
